Certificates of Destruction for Project-Based Services
For one-time projects and scheduled purges, we issue Certificates of Destruction documenting what was destroyed, when, and by whom — the paper trail your audit, legal, or compliance team needs on file. Ongoing recurring contracts (regular bin pickups, weekly or monthly service) are documented through contract terms and service records rather than per-pickup certificates — we can walk through which model fits your compliance framework during scoping.
Scheduled and On-Demand Service, Tailored to How You Operate
Every business has a different destruction rhythm. A small practice might need quarterly pickups, a law firm might need bins swapped weekly, and a construction company might only need a destruction day when a project closes out. We build the schedule around your operations — container placement, pickup frequency, and turnaround — rather than fitting you into a generic service window. One-time purges are welcome too: clearing out a back room before a move, closing a satellite office, or catching up on a backlog of boxes.
